Carbery make plastic coal bunkers, usually available from the same suppliers as their oil tanks. I know Atlantic in Suffolk stock Carbery and will deliver to you - they advertise various sizes on eBay, but you can often get things a bit cheaper if you ring and order direct (01986 891074).
Do a search on eBay for "Carbery coal bunker" to get an idea of the prices.

I bought my coal bunker from gardenoasis.co.uk. It is a galvanised one and the 5cwt one I got holds about a years worth of coal for my little place. :j
Delivery was free and I paid just under £70 but they do a smaller one which is cheaper.
